lib: fix __fdt_parse_region()

If fdt_getprop() returns NULL, this indicates an error. In this case lenp
is set to an error code. But even if lenp = 0 we should not continue.

If fdt_getprop() returns a wider value than we expect this is a separate
error condition.

In both cases the device-tree is invalid.

Addresses-Coverity-ID: 1529703 ("Dereference after null check")
